Supplier Quality Engineer

Supplier Quality Engineer responsible for on-site supplier qualification, auditing, and issue resolution to ensure compliant, high-quality materials and components for manufacturing.

Job Requirements

Experience with supplier audits, qualification processes, and maintaining Approved Supplier Lists in alignment with GMP and regulatory standards

Strong understanding of quality management systems, regulatory requirements, and compliance project support within a manufacturing or medical device environment

Proficiency in identifying, investigating, and resolving supplier-related issues using structured problem-solving methodologies

Experience managing supplier quality activities such as PPAPs, control plans, and product acceptance sampling strategies

Ability to work on-site 5 days per week

Preferred Skills

Experience administering or supporting a Certified Supplier Program within receiving inspection

Background monitoring parts from acquisition through the manufacturing cycle in a regulated environment

Experience supporting Supplier Owned Quality deployment and new product introduction activities

Familiarity with GMP principles and supplier auditing best practices

Job Responsibilities

Drive and manage supplier quality activities related to projects, including Approved Supplier List (ASL) updates, PPAPs, and general project support

Ensure suppliers deliver quality parts, materials, and services that meet company and regulatory requirements

Qualify suppliers according to company standards and support or administer Certified Supplier Programs for cost-effective receiving inspection

Monitor supplied parts from acquisition through the manufacturing cycle and communicate/resolve supplier-related problems as they occur

Develop, maintain, and prioritize an auditing schedule to ensure designated suppliers are audited regularly for GMP and quality compliance

Evaluate suppliers’ internal functions to assess overall performance and provide feedback on their operations

Collaborate with Component Engineers to develop and deliver Product Acceptance Sampling Strategies, ASL coordination, Supplier Owned Quality deployment, and Control Plans for new products
